Se hela listan på de.wikibooks.org

6128

VBA For Loop. The For Loop is scope that defines a list of statements that will be executed repeatably for a certain number of times. The For Loop is the most often used loop for situations when the number of iterationsvb is know before the loop is executed (as compared to the While and Do Until Loops). How to declare a For Loop:

The For loop is typically used   with a built-in Excel function. In this section we will review the various options available in VBA for writing loops and examine several example applications. When learning Excel VBA, you need to know how to use loops competently. By using loops we can walk through a range of values, rows, sheets or other objects   What Is An Excel VBA Loop. Defined very broadly, looping is repeating the execution of certain statements more than one time. Therefore, when you want or need  Hi all, I have a code below that works perfectly fine in excel 2010. I've upgraded to 2013 and now my excel gets the not responding issue, along with the Discover the best Microsoft VBA in Best Sellers.

Vba for i

  1. Byggkeramikrådet logga
  2. Hemsida kostnader

VBA helps to develop automation processes, Windows API, and user-defined functions. It also enables you to manipulate the user interface features of the host applications. Else, it has limited usage in excel VBA. The advantage for “Each” keyword is only that we don’t have declare steps like from 1 to x in the “For” statement. Recommended Articles. This is a guide to VBA For Each Loop. Here we discuss how to use For Each Loop in Excel using VBA code along with practical examples and downloadable excel The letter L looks like the number 1 in VBA, so I'm now using i as the variable name even though I use Long as the data type. This is all a matter of personal preference and you can name the variable whatever you want.

Jul 26, 2017 Learn how to write the For Next Loop in VBA to run the same lines of code on a collection of objects or set of numbers. Save time automating 

As the image above shows - taken from the Excel VBA menu-(download here), there are many ways one can specify ranges to loop through. In this article several ways are discussed to do this.

Vba for i

You can use the Step keyword in Excel VBA to specify a different increment for the counter variable of a loop. 1. Place a command button on your worksheet and add the following code lines: Dim i As Integer

Sub AddFirst10PositiveIntegers() Dim i As Integer i = 1 Do Until i > 10 Result = Result + i i = i + 1 Loop MsgBox Result End Sub Part Description; element: Required.

Vba for i

freelancer, must show previous work..and demonstrate capabilities. Skills: Excel, Visual Basic, Visual Basic for Apps, Data Processing, Data Entry VBA-Code-Library. The VBA library is a set of methods that I have used over the years to help me work accurately and efficiently. I inldued the modules so others can use and modify for their own use. The Excel file has all the modules and all the references included to be able to use once downloaded. Mod_Autofilter.bas methods: VBA Macro multiple filter 25 EUR FIXED PRICE READ CAREFULLY (€18-36 EUR / hour) I am looking for a high level miner & excel vba expert. ($30-250 USD) Excel File to Tally Conveter (₹1500-12500 INR) Convert my excel sheet (Excel Macro) to application ($10-30 USD) shopify and excel vba expert ($2-8 AUD / hour) Data Science Questions in R ($250 Vil du øge dine kompetencer inden for IT og gøre dig selv mere attraktiv på arbejdsmarkedet?
Kasimir

Dessa färdigheter  VBA for modelers : developing decision support systems with Microsoft Excel-book.

Hjälp med VBA-programmering för MS Word, Mac. 1317 visningar. Svar av iSweden 2018-04-28.
Europe borders

Vba for i real bnp exempel
illikvid aktie
pension 80ccd
bli av med vätska i kroppen
inventor 50 in 1 engino
svenskt uppehållstillstånd resa utomlands

For a = 1 To 3 Step 1 ), after the 3rd time through the loop, a is incremented to 4. As that is greater than 3, it stops and displays 4. In Test2 (i.e. For a = 1 To 3 Step -1 ), a is initially set to 1. As that is already less than 3, it immediately stops and displays 1.

Suppose you have a dataset and you want to highlight all the cells in even rows. VBA For Loop. The For Loop is scope that defines a list of statements that will be executed repeatably for a certain number of times. The For Loop is the most often used loop for situations when the number of iterationsvb is know before the loop is executed (as compared to the While and Do Until Loops). How to declare a For Loop: Example 8: Use VBA For Loop Protect all sheets in Workbook. In this example, we will try to create a VBA macro that loops through all the worksheets in the active workbook and protects all the worksheets. Below is the code to do this: Excel VBA Tutorial Part 6: VBA Loops - The For, Do-While and Do-Until Loops.

Following is the syntax of a for loop in VBA. For counter = start To end [Step stepcount] [statement 1] [statement 2] . [statement n] [Exit For] [statement 11] [statement 22] . [statement n] Next Flow Diagram. Following is the flow of control in a For Loop − The For step is executed first.

Aug 7, 2017 This post will guide you how to use loops statements in MS excel VBA. There are three most useful Loops statements as bellows: For … Oct 9, 2016 Application of the VBA ForNext statement to a discount factor example. Aug 23, 2017 In this post, I'd like to build on top of that knowledge by showing you how to loop through cells in VBA. There are a few ways to loop through cells  När du skriver ett Microsoft Visual Basic for Applications (VBA) -makro kan du behöva gå igenom en lista med data i ett kalkylblad. Det finns  This book is the third and final book in the Microsoft VBA Codes Are Fun, Simple, and Easy to Learn In One Hour or Less series. Since I've already explained  Singel Loop | Double Loop | Triple Loop | Gör medan Loop. Looping är en av de mest kraftfulla programmeringsteknikerna.

Below is the code to do this: Sadly there are no operation-assignment operators in VBA. (Addition-assignment += are available in VB.Net) Pointless workaround; Sub Inc(ByRef i As Integer) i = i + 1 End Sub Static value As Integer inc value inc value IntroductionThis is a tutorial about writing code in Excel spreadsheets using Visual Basic for Applications (VBA). Excel is one of Microsoft’s most popular products.